Question 1: A lender provides a recovery agent with a 'starter interrupt' device already installed in a repossessed vehicle. What is the primary compliance concern when using this device?
- It may void the vehicle warranty
- State laws vary on whether remote immobilization is permitted before repossession (Correct answer)
- The device will interfere with LPR cameras
- It automatically notifies the debtor
Correct answer: State laws vary on whether remote immobilization is permitted before repossession
Several states restrict or prohibit use of starter interrupt devices, so agents must verify local laws before relying on them.

Question 3: Social media intelligence (SOCMINT) tools are used in skip tracing primarily to:
- File electronic lien releases
- Identify debtor locations from public posts, check-ins, and profile data (Correct answer)
- Decrypt debtor financial records
- Submit repossession notices to courts
Correct answer: Identify debtor locations from public posts, check-ins, and profile data
SOCMINT tools monitor public social media to surface real-time location clues such as tagged photos, check-ins, and employer mentions.

Question 5: When a recovery agent's GPS unit shows a vehicle's last-known location is inside a closed gated community, the BEST technology-assisted next step is to:
- Immediately contact local police to enter the community
- Cross-reference LPR data and debtor address history to determine if the vehicle may have relocated (Correct answer)
- Disable the vehicle remotely via telematics
- List the vehicle as unrecoverable in the RMS
Correct answer: Cross-reference LPR data and debtor address history to determine if the vehicle may have relocated
Combining LPR scan history with skip tracing data can reveal alternate addresses or frequent travel patterns before escalating.
Question 6: Electronic forwarding platforms (e.g., DRN, MVTRAC) primarily connect:
- Courts and lenders for title transfers
- Lenders with a national network of licensed recovery agencies (Correct answer)
- DMVs with auction houses
- Insurance carriers with salvage yards
Correct answer: Lenders with a national network of licensed recovery agencies
Electronic forwarding platforms allow lenders to broadcast assignments to vetted recovery agencies and track progress digitally.
